extref clear did not remove session ", $self->_data_alias_loggable($session) ); } } } # Fetch the number of sessions with extra references held in the # entire system. sub _data_extref_count { return scalar keys %kr_extra_refs; } # Fetch whether a session has extra references. sub _data_extref_count_ses { my ($self, $session) = @_; return 0 unless exists $kr_extra_refs{$session}; return scalar keys %{$kr_extra_refs{$session}}; } 1; __END__ =head1 NAME POE::Resource::Extrefs - internal reference counts manager for POE::Kernel =head1 SYNOPSIS There is no public API. =head1 DESCRIPTION POE::Resource::Extrefs is a mix-in class for POE::Kernel. It provides the features to manage session reference counts, specifically the ones that applications may use. POE::Resource::Extrefs is used internally by POE::Kernel, so it has no public interface. =head1 SEE ALSO See L for the public extref API. See L for for public information about POE resources. See L for general discussion about resources and the classes that manage them. =head1 BUGS Reference counters have no ownership information, so one entity's reference counts may conflict with another's. This is usually not a problem if all entities behave. =head1 AUTHORS & COPYRIGHTS Please see L for more information about authors and contributors. =cut # rocco // vim: ts=2 sw=2 expandtab
